Never Buy Motorola

Zero stars please. I have a Moto Stylus 5G. This is the ABSOLUTE worst device I have ever had the displeasure of owning. This thing is totally non responsive. I attempted to answer a phone call moments ago but the phone app refused to open. I missed the call. Text messages simply do not send. Web works for moments at a time. WiFi is operation is a serious gamble. Motorola has gone to trash. I will Never EVER buy anything from Motorola again.

Caveat Emptor

Caveat Emptor, Buyer beware. Absolutely terrible experience. Not one I'd like to repeat.During the month of November 2025, while preparing Christmas gift ideas for my wife to give me, I was looking at different phones on the internet. I was looking through the details as to what each phone could do, such as battery life, signal, SIM cards, price, camera, memory storage etc.I took the opportunity to e-mail the customer service department of Motorola and suggested a couple of models I was looking at that meet my specific needs which I outlined and sought recommendation -from someone experienced and knowledgeable- of a mobile phone that would meet with my needs as outlined. These emails were exchanged between the 19th and 21st November 2025.Following assurances from the customer service department that a particular model would meet with my specifications the most important of which was 2 physical SIM cards and a good size battery, I placed an order on the 21st of November 2025.The order was paid for by bank transfer on the same day.The phone arrived on the 27th of November 2025.On the 28th of November, I opened the box to make sure the model would actually take the 2 physical SIM cards. In truth, I could not figure it out. On 1st of December, I sent an e-mail to the sales representative who told me that there had been a misunderstanding – or perhaps she was misinformed- by the manager.Due to the fact that it did not meet my most important criteria, the return of phone was organised on the 1st of December 2025, and labels were emailed to me on the 2nd.The parcel was dropped off at the local post office on the 3rd of December 2025 and was successfully delivered the parcel to the Motorola distribution centre on the 9th of December 2025.There was no communication from Motorola and so after Christmas on the 6th of January 2026, I rang Motorola customer service department to be told that the package had to go to The Netherlands. There was no confirmation on the system to confirm the returned phone had been received in The Netherlands. I was told there was a system to automatically acknowledge receipt in the return depot which would advise me three to five business days after it was received.On the 9th of January 2026, I tried calling the sales agent that I had spoken to and been in email contact with before, but she was not available and she was to ring me back. On the 13th of January 2026, I rang customer care, and I spoke with an agent there who put me on hold while checking the details and told me that my refund had been approved on the 7th of January 2026.There had been no communication to advise that the phone had been received, or that the refund team were looking at it. There was no communication to say that the refund was in progress. There had been absolutely no communication initiated by Motorola.The lady explained that, following approval on the 7th of January, it would take 7 to 14 working days for the processing of a refund back to my original method of payment. She explained that that particular day -the 13th of January 2026, - would count as the 4th business day since the refund was approved.On the 16th of January 2026, I once again rang customer care and was speaking to the same lady whom I asked for a status update.I then got an e-mail confirmation to say that the refund had been approved but would take 7-14 business days to process, and that the 16th of January was actually the 8th day since the refund approval was granted.On the 28th of January 2026, I had still not received a refund which would have been due to hit my account before, or during the 27th of January 2026.On this call -the 28th of January 2026- the customer service agent put me on hold and went to check with the team. I was then told that my bank details were required considering it was a bank transfer that was used for the purchase.I cannot understand why in the 7 - 14 business days that it says it will take to process a refund, nobody got in touch with me to look for my bank details. I truly believe that had I not initiated the call, maybe Motorola would not have contacted me seeking the account number.It was not until 9th of February 2026 that I received my refund.

Motorola Razr screen protector keeps coming loose…

The screen protector keeps coming loose on the Razor and they don't ship the parts to their authorized repair facilities. Only option is to replace it, or ship it back to them, which can take up to four weeks to repair and return. My business is based on this phone, and I can't be without it. So I went for the cross ship exchange. And the replacement was worse than the original. Only option now is to purchase a new one. Unbelievable. I personally will not buy another Motorola. EVER. And would strongly recommend you not either.
